Future maintainers,

This documents Saturday's drill for the Ledgerloom reconciliation job. We will simulate loss of the Bratten warehouse datastore mid-run, then restore from the hourly snapshot and replay the delta log. Expect the job to flag roughly two hours of unreconciled SKUs; that is normal and self-heals on the next pass. Take careful notes on replay duration — last year's numbers were never recorded. Restoring the snapshot requires unlocking the archive, which accepts the passphrase below.

vault phrase of bagaf-kajeg = jorath-feniel-briir-siliel-ralix

MEMO — Branch Managers

Our latest review shows Tarlow Fabrication now accounts for 38% of total revenue, up from 24% last year. This concentration exposes every branch to a single client's purchasing cycle. Effective immediately, new-business targets are weighted toward accounts outside the Tarlow relationship, and quarterly reporting will track concentration by branch. Diversification efforts should be framed to clients carefully, for the reasons set out in the confidential note below.

management briefing: Aldokax Foods plans to raise the Fenok list price by 63.8 percent in March. The board signed off on a budget of $97.5 million for Project Istius. The renewal with Raliusek Group closes at $142.1 million a year, 32.6 percent above the last contract. Project Olidor slips by two quarters because of the tooling delay.

FABL-412: Seedsmith factory library emits duplicate surrogate keys when traits are nested more than two deep. Repro: build an Order with customer + address traits under parallel workers. New folks: this is the sequence counter not being fork-safe, not your test. Workaround is serial mode until the patch lands. Fix is merged on Harwick's branch and staged. Confirm against the build referenced immediately below.

trace token, kahog-tajeg: htk6_97d963